The WATER SYSTEMS OPERATION GROUP of the Metropolitan Water District reliably treats and delivers high quality water in an efficient, sustainable, and environmentally responsible manner. To accomplish this mission, more than 900 Water System Operations employees operate, maintain and repair a vast and complex water and power system extending from the Colorado River to the Pacific Ocean.


This water system serves more than 19 million Californians and supports one of the largest economies in the world. Metropolitan’s vast network of aqueducts, pipelines, treatment facilities and power transmission system are the backbone of Southern California’s regional water system, delivering about half of the water used on the Southern California coastal plain. This flexible and adaptable system enables Metropolitan to move water across six counties from where it is sourced to where it is needed.

ABOUT MWD
The Metropolitan Water District of Southern California is a consortium of 26 cities and water districts that provides drinking water to nearly 19 million people in Southern California. Metropolitan’s mission is to provide its service area with adequate and reliable supplies of high quality water to meet current and future needs in an environmentally and economically responsible way. Metropolitan’s facilities include the 242-mile Colorado River Aqueduct, five water treatment plants with a combined capacity of 2.3 billion gallons per day, nine surface water reservoirs, 800 miles of pipeline, and 16 hydroelectric power plants.
